The K-3 visa was created to help spouses of American citizens reduce the time of separation while awaiting the completion of the permanent residency process. It is an option for couples where the American citizen has already initiated the immigration process for their spouse but has encountered delays in the approval of the traditional immigration petition.
To sponsor the K-3 visa, the responsible party is exclusively the American citizen spouse. First, this citizen must have filed the immigration petition (Form I-130) on behalf of the foreign spouse. This step is fundamental, as the existence of the petition proves the validity of the marital relationship and starts the process that will enable the K-3 visa application.
In other words, there is no other person or entity that can carry out this sponsorship; the role of sponsor is inherent to the status of being a United States citizen, and it is this citizen who formalizes and supports the entire application.
